Tinkercad design

A design I made on Tinkercad:
This design was made using a 3D designing platform called Tinkercad. 
For the main shape of the dill gauge, I used an octangular pyramid with an eight-sided diamond on top. On each face of the octangular pyramid, I put a hole with the measurement of the diameter underneath it. Similar to the drill gauge I made in class, this drill gauge has holes measuring at 3mm, 4mm, 5mm, 5.5mm, 6mm, 6.8mm, 8mm, and 10mm. 

Method:
1. Create an ordinary pyramid using the basic shapes menu on the right-hand side of your screen.
2. Click on the shape and then change the number of sides the shape has from 4 to 8.
    by doing this you have created an 8 sided pyramid called an octangular pyramid.
3. Create 8 cylinders using the same menu on the right-hand side of your screen.
4. Change the height of all of the cylinders to whatever the height of your octangular pyramid is.
5. On the first cylinder, change the width of the cylinder to 3 by 3.
6. On the second one, change it to 4 by 4.
7. The third one to 5 by 5, the fourth one to 5.5 by 5.5, the fifth one to 6 by 6, the sixth one to 6.8 by
     6.8, the seventh one to 8 by 8, the eighth one to 10 by 10.
8. Then highlight and select all of the cylinders and change them all into holes.
9. Once you have changed the cylinders to holes, put them on each face of the octangular
    pyramid.
10. Highlight and select everything you have done so far, then click Ctrl + G to group everything 
      together.
11. After following these steps, your design should look like this

12. Make a box and turn it into a hole.
13. Put it on top of your octangular pyramid. Make sure that you don't cover your holes with your 
      box.
14. highlight and select the box and your pyramid, then group them together.
15. This should create a flat area on top of your pyramid. It should look like this

16. Grab a diamond shape and then flip it upside down.
17. Put it on top of the flat area and aline each face of the diamond to each face of your pyramid.

18. Select the two shapes and then group them together.

19. Grab a text shape. Then change its shape from text to 3
20. Grab seven more and change the shapes each of them to match the measurements of the holes.
21. Change the size of the texts so that it can fit on the faces of your pyramid. Then put on on your pyramid.
22. Select all of your shapes and then group them together.
23.  FINISH.
